Output ef934ab64d6715ebb0c0af47f23dc14300358fca1d9c3b5ef3a695bc2d13ee87:0

value
7917035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bdc1cfd22b93ba674ad0a6291d253c39431e13c OP_EQUAL
address
35gvfXbXvb5VGnU1eZUrEkcYYUWFbEc3P7
transaction
ef934ab64d6715ebb0c0af47f23dc14300358fca1d9c3b5ef3a695bc2d13ee87
spent
true